Where risk concentrates

Areas to be cautious in Rimini

These locations are specifically cited in documented scam reports for Rimini. Exercise heightened awareness in these areas.

Restaurant Overcharging and Coperto Confusion

Tourist-facing restaurants near the Rimini waterfront promenade, restaurants in the historic centre near Piazza Tre Martiri, seafront restaurants in the Rivazzurra and Miramare resort areas

medium

Beach Sunbed Unofficial Fee Collection

Public beach sections between official stabilimento concessions along the 15km Rimini beach strip, particularly at the far northern and southern ends where zones are less clearly marked

low

Nightclub Entry Inflated Pricing

Club circuit venues along the Riviera Romagnola strip, promoter positions near the main beach access roads in the evening, areas near Riccione (adjacent resort town)

medium

Counterfeit Goods at the Street Market

Wednesday outdoor market near Rimini railway station, beach vendor pitches along the waterfront, evening market stalls near the historic centre

low

Beach Vendor Overpricing

Beach vendor pitches along the main Rimini waterfront, particularly in the public beach sections where stabilimento kiosk coverage is thinner

low

What are the most dangerous areas in Rimini for tourists?
Based on documented incident reports, the highest-risk areas in Rimini include: Tourist-facing restaurants near the Rimini waterfront promenade, restaurants in the historic centre near Piazza Tre Martiri, seafront restaurants in the Rivazzurra and Miramare resort areas. Public beach sections between official stabilimento concessions along the 15km Rimini beach strip, particularly at the far northern and southern ends where zones are less clearly marked. Club circuit venues along the Riviera Romagnola strip, promoter positions near the main beach access roads in the evening, areas near Riccione (adjacent resort town). These areas are associated with restaurant scams, street scams, other scams incidents.
